iscsiadm命令是Linux中的一个命令行工具,用于管理iSCSI(Internet Small Computer System Interface)存储协议。
该命令的主要作用包括:
发现iSCSI目标:可以使用iscsiadm命令来发现并列出可用的iSCSI目标(即存储设备)。这可以通过执行iscsiadm -m discovery
命令来实现。
登录和注销iSCSI目标:通过iscsiadm命令,可以使用iSCSI协议登录到目标存储设备,或者注销已登录的设备。使用iscsiadm -m node
命令来控制登录和注销过程。
配置iSCSI目标:iscsiadm命令还可以用于配置iSCSI目标的各种属性,如启动时自动登录、CHAP(Challenge-Handshake Authentication Protocol)认证等。可以使用iscsiadm -m node -T <target_name> -p <portal_IP:port> -l
命令来登录iSCSI目标,并使用iscsiadm -m node -T <target_name> -p <portal_IP:port> -u
命令来注销iSCSI目标。
查看iSCSI目标和会话信息:使用iscsiadm -m session
命令可以列出当前活动的iSCSI会话,包括已登录的目标和相关的会话信息。
查看和修改iSCSI设置:通过iscsiadm命令,可以查看和修改系统中的iSCSI设置和配置文件。可以使用iscsiadm -m node -l
命令来加载并应用iSCSI配置文件。
总之,iscsiadm命令是Linux系统中用于管理iSCSI存储协议的重要工具,可以进行发现、登录、注销、配置和监控iSCSI目标和会话。